Board: Varnell Systems proposes 412 total heads next year, up 6%. Growth concentrated in Meridock engineering (18 adds) and the Ostrevale support hub (9 adds). Sales flat; back-office reduced by 4 through attrition. Fully loaded cost rises 5.1%, within the envelope approved in June. Contractor spend trimmed 12% to offset. Risks: wage inflation in Ostrevale and delayed backfills in compliance. Finance recommends approval with a Q2 checkpoint. The rationale behind the engineering concentration is set out below.

management briefing: Project Ulavan slips by two quarters because of the staffing delay.

Alert: SQL Lint Failures Blocking Merges

Heads up, support folks — you may get tickets about the new SQL linter in Pondwright CI rejecting files that merged fine last month. We turned on stricter rules for keyword casing and missing semicolons, and older branches trip them constantly. The fix is usually a one-line change, not a real bug. The full rule list and how to request an exemption are on the internal page here.

operations page: https://jenkins.zemvarcloud.local/job/merge_requests/repo/build/73930b4b30f0a8ed

TURN-208: Gatevale turnstile counters at the Merrow Field pilot double-count when a rotation reverses mid-cycle. Attendance totals drift roughly 2% high per event. The debounce window fix is implemented, reviewed by Ilsa, and soak-tested across two simulated match days without drift. Ready for your cut; the candidate build is identified below.

trace token, tagag-tafog: htk6_5ed18c